The curriculum at Newington High School provides varied programs for students to secure the type of education best suited to their particular needs, interests, and abilities. It is designed to prepare all students for higher education and/or entry into the world of work. The choice of sound programs to meet individual requirements is of foremost importance. Wise planning will take into account the setting of realistic goals based on capabilities and interests. The acquisition of knowledge is but one element of a good education. The development of skills that lead to: effective communication, collaboration, critical thinking, problem solving, and positive citizenship are also essential elements of students' education.
